## Payroll Export Limits

As of the v4 cutover, Ledgerhawk payroll exports use chunked CSV instead of single-file XML. Chunks cap at 5,000 rows; exceeding the daily quota queues the job until midnight UTC. New contractors: do not raise limits without sign-off from the Finholm platform team. Retry behavior is governed by the constants below, which the export worker reads at startup.

tuning table, yajog-yahof:
BUDGETS = {
    "lamvan": 303,
    "wenox": 460,
    "fenvan": 525,
}

# Liftwise Simulator — Environments

Plugin authors should be aware that Liftwise runs three distinct environments: `sandbox`, `cert`, and `live`. Each environment enforces its own dispatch tick rate, car-count ceiling, and plugin timeout, so a plugin validated in sandbox may still be throttled in cert. Always query the environment endpoint at startup rather than hardcoding assumptions. For reference, the current cert environment settings are reproduced below.

settings of bawif-fawif:
ralix:
  log_level: warn
  metrics_host: metrics.ralix.tolvaqsys.internal
  pool_size: 32

Capacity note for the Bramblewick export retry queue. Failed exports are requeued with exponential backoff, and the queue depth is our main capacity signal: sustained depth above the high-water mark means downstream Pellis storage is saturated, not that we need more workers. As the new contractor, please don't raise worker counts without checking storage latency first — it usually makes things worse. Retry timing, backoff caps, and the high-water threshold are all driven by the constants shown below.

limits module of yagef-bajog:
TIERS = {
    "druael": 370,
    "tamix": 286,
    "pelius": 541,
    "pelael": 78,
    "pelox": 47,
    "ralath": 533,
    "drumir": 801,
}

Ticket: Watchdog config drift on Kettleway kiosks. Several kiosks at the Marrow Street site are rebooting every 20 minutes because the watchdog heartbeat interval was changed locally during a field visit and now disagrees with fleet policy. On-call: do not silence the alerts; the drift will recur after provisioning. Instead, reset each affected unit's watchdog to the values that follow.

settings of fafog-haduf:
ZORIX_PIN=4648
ZORIX_METRICS_HOST=metrics.zorix.paliqsys.corp
ZORIX_LOG_LEVEL=info
ZORIX_TENANT=druix